Conversion formula
The conversion factor from liters to tablespoons is 67.62804511761, which means that 1 liter is equal to 67.62804511761 tablespoons:
1 L = 67.62804511761 tbsp
To convert 377 liters into tablespoons we have to multiply 377 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from liters to tablespoons.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 L → 67.62804511761 tbsp
377 L → V(tbsp)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in tablespoons:
V(tbsp) = 377 L × 67.62804511761 tbsp
V(tbsp) = 25495.773009339 tbsp
The final result is:
377 L → 25495.773009339 tbsp
We conclude that 377 liters is equivalent to 25495.773009339 tablespoons:
377 liters = 25495.773009339 tablespoons
